Output e431f51d8a89b1afc9e63d50152b3d7e3c825494762eb24ff91cdbce3d73e43f:1

value
90558994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c534e419d7ad63a9a82f4dd12d85d37e3b386ae0 OP_EQUAL
address
3KfkQGRkaY454pUZ89mSdxPD9bGD39oHgB
transaction
e431f51d8a89b1afc9e63d50152b3d7e3c825494762eb24ff91cdbce3d73e43f
spent
true